Output 63043fa7e7bc7947ff0c0eac586aa0695f7dd764660cdc5bf6411cfedb084d56:22
- value
- 28753393
- script pubkey
- OP_0 OP_PUSHBYTES_20 8cadad9ea7a596cba8e033612c93ca76815ff5cc
- address
- bc1q3jk6m8485ktvh28qxdsjey72w6q4lawvn8q45h
- transaction
- 63043fa7e7bc7947ff0c0eac586aa0695f7dd764660cdc5bf6411cfedb084d56